No-Bake Chocolate-Almond Oat Bars (Guten Free)
1 cup smooth almond butter
1/2 cup honey
1 stick unsalted butter
2 cups rolled oats (Bobs Red Mill produces gluten-free, available at Bradley Park Publix
or P'tree Natural Foods)
6 ounces bittersweet chocolate (at least 70% cacao preferable)
1 cup pure shredded coconut
1/2 teaspoon salt
Coat an 8-inch square baking pan with cooking spray. Line with parchment, leaving 2
inches of overhang on 2 sides. Melt almond butter, honey, and butter in a saucepan
over medium heat, stirring frequently, about 6 minutes. Remove from heat and add
remaining ingredients, stirring until chocolate has melted and ingredients are well
combined.
Pour mixture into prepared pan. Refrigerate until chocolate hardens, at least 3 hours
and up to 1 day. Run an knife around the edges, then use parchment paper to remove
from paper and transfer to cutting board. Cut into bars. Bars can be stored in
refrigerator for up to 3 days.
